The 3 Core Problems That Stop Finance Companies Scaling
Lead flow is broken — inconsistent volume, rising cost per lead, no ability to forecast Contact and follow-up rates are too low and too slow Team structure isn’t built for profitability or scale When all three compound on each other CAC becomes uncontrollable, leads get wasted and the business becomes high risk with thin margins.

The Dual Funnel System
Run two funnels simultaneously. Each has a specific role.
Funnel 1: Direct Response Lead Funnel
Structure:
Ad → Landing Page → Form → Thank You Page → CRM
Purpose:
Refines your sales process before scaling gets complex Target volume: 400 to 600 leads per month to start
Funnel 2: VSL Funnel
Educational video pre-sells the offer Lower volume, higher quality Targets people who need more convincing before they act Target volume: 100 to 200 leads per month
Why run both:
If one funnel’s cost per lead spikes the other stabilises Different intent levels covered simultaneously VSL funnel grows over time as trust in the market builds When to add each:
Start with direct response only — build and refine the sales process first Add VSL funnel when scaling from $80K to $160K per month Add external agency and more pay per lead providers at $160K to $250K per month The In-House Media Team
At scale you need internal creative capacity. Not just an agency.
Roles:
Designer — owns all creative output, ads, landing pages, thumbnails Editor — video content, reels, ad variations Media Buyer — runs the numbers, kills losers, scales winners Why internal and agency together:
There is a rule called the sum of 50. In any creative team, 50% of output comes from the top 10% of people. One agency means one person driving most of your creative. Add an in-house team and you now have two separate top performers driving output independently with different expertise.
One media buyer is never enough at serious spend levels.
Why CAC Climbs
Creative volume is too low Funnel isn’t aligned with all awareness levels — only targeting the hottest, smallest segment of the market Relying on one funnel type instead of running multiple simultaneously Offer avatar mismatch — attracting the wrong leads because targeting isn’t refined to your best settled clients STAGE 2: Install Speed Systems
The Problem
First contact happening hours after opt-in Follow-up not standardised No speed to second appointment tracking SDRs not booking meetings from meetings The 5-Minute Speed To Lead Rule
Contact within 5 minutes of opt-in during business hours 10 minutes is a danger zone 60 minutes and the lead is mostly dead MIT sourced data: 21x increase in contact rate when leads are called within 5 minutes versus after 30 minutes.
BAMFAM Rule
Book A Meeting From A Meeting.
Every call must end with the next appointment already booked.
Open the calendar before hanging up Lock in the next step immediately If they won’t book a time there is an unhandled objection — find it Most deals stall between opportunity and application.
The gap between the first and second call is where revenue disappears.
BAMFAM closes that gap.
Speed To Second Appointment (Hidden KPI)
Most businesses track speed to lead.
Almost none track speed to application.
Target: application booked same day as first call where possible.
Follow up within 60 minutes after every call.
Speed equals trust. Trust equals conversion.
